BATAVIA, N.Y. — The New York Civil Liberties Union announced a settlement that will stop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) from opening mail sent to immigrant detainees at the federal detention facility in Batavia.
ICE had previously argued that documents were tainted with drugs and that mail was opened in front of detainees. However, the agency will now honor its prior policy.
ICE has not responded to a request for comment.
